Fontaine Modification acquisition to support nearby Peterbilt plant

Feb. 26, 2025
The ProBilt Services location in Denton, Texas is Fontaine's eleventh modification center nationwide,

Fontaine Modification has acquired ProBilt Services, an upfitter located three miles from Peterbilt’s Denton, Texas, truck manufacturing facility. With the acquisition, Fontaine is expanding the modification and upfit services it offers for Peterbilt trucks and others.

Joining Fontaine's other two Texas modification center locations in Garland and Laredo, the Denton site includes a 30,000 sq.-ft. facility with parking for 250 trucks. Configured for post-production truck upfits and modifications, including body modification and drivetrain changes primarily to heavy-duty Peterbilt truck models, the location also installs clean fuel technology, including options for battery electric, hybrid, and alternative-fuel vehicles.

The move follows Fontaine’s 2019 acquisition of the other ProBilt Services operation located near the Kenworth plant in Chillicothe, Ohio, and makes 11 modification centers for the company nationwide.

“This acquisition strengthens our position in the heavy-truck industry, provides new opportunities for growth, and expands our ability to support our customers,” said Jamil Young, Fontaine Modification president. “We look forward to continuing to build on ProBilt’s reputation for quality and reliability.”

Fontaine acquired ProBilt from its founders, Toney Fitzgerald and Fred Toothman. While Fitzgerald has chosen to retire, the rest of the ProBilt team will continue with Fontaine, led by Toothman as the Denton operations manager.
